Integrated Marketing is a comprehensive strategy that unifies a brand's message across various marketing channels, ensuring consistent customer interactions. This approach, also known as omnichannel marketing, seamlessly blends digital and traditional marketing channels to create a cohesive brand experience. By leveraging both online and offline channels, businesses can reach their diverse audience effectively, considering the preferences and behaviors of modern consumers.
The success of integrated marketing relies on a well-thought-out channel integration strategy. This involves defining goals, understanding the target audience, maintaining consistent messaging, allocating resources wisely, and utilizing data analytics for informed decision-making. The choice between online and offline marketing depends on factors like audience, industry, and budget, each having its own set of advantages and disadvantages.
Cross-channel marketing plays a crucial role in this strategy, integrating different channels to provide customers with a seamless experience. The real-world success stories of companies like Maggi, Gatwick Airport, CenturyLink, and Panasonic highlight the effectiveness of integrated marketing in reaching diverse audiences and driving substantial revenue impact.
As businesses explore various marketing channels and create their channel integration strategy, consistency, adaptability, and data-driven decision-making emerge as pillars of success in integrated marketing. Online advertising, also known as online marketing, Internet advertising, digital advertising or web advertising, is a form of marketing and advertising which uses the Internet to deliver promotional marketing messages to consumers. online advertising frequently involves a publisher, who integrates advertisements into its online content, and an advertiser, who provides the advertisements to be displayed on the publisher's content.
Internet Advertising is a set of tools for delivering promotional message to people worldwide, using the internet as a global marketing platform. Internet advertising is a way to demonstrate your offers in front of over 4.3 billion web users around the globe. The global online advertising industry size reached US $186.6 billion in 2021. The Roman Empire, a vast and enduring power, stands as one of history's most remarkable civilizations, leaving an indelible imprint on the world. It emerged from the Roman Republic, transitioning into an imperial powerhouse under the leadership of Augustus Caesar in 27 BCE. This transformation marked the beginning of an era defined by unprecedented territorial expansion, architectural marvels, and profound cultural influence.
The empire's roots lie in the city of Rome, founded, according to legend, by Romulus in 753 BCE. Over centuries, Rome evolved from a small settlement to a formidable republic, characterized by a complex political system with elected officials and checks on power. However, internal strife, class conflicts, and military ambitions paved the way for the end of the Republic. Julius Caesar’s dictatorship and subsequent assassination in 44 BCE created a power vacuum, leading to a civil war. Octavian, later Augustus, emerged victorious, heralding the Roman Empire’s birth.
Under Augustus, the empire experienced the Pax Romana, a 200-year period of relative peace and stability. Augustus reformed the military, established efficient administrative systems, and initiated grand construction projects. The empire's borders expanded, encompassing territories from Britain to Egypt and from Spain to the Euphrates. Roman legions, renowned for their discipline and engineering prowess, secured and maintained these vast territories, building roads, fortifications, and cities that facilitated control and integration.
The Roman Empire’s society was hierarchical, with a rigid class system. At the top were the patricians, wealthy elites who held significant political power. Below them were the plebeians, free citizens with limited political influence, and the vast numbers of slaves who formed the backbone of the economy. The family unit was central, governed by the paterfamilias, the male head who held absolute authority.
Culturally, the Romans were eclectic, absorbing and adapting elements from the civilizations they encountered, particularly the Greeks. Roman art, literature, and philosophy reflected this synthesis, creating a rich cultural tapestry. Latin, the Roman language, became the lingua franca of the Western world, influencing numerous modern languages.
Roman architecture and engineering achievements were monumental. They perfected the arch, vault, and dome, constructing enduring structures like the Colosseum, Pantheon, and aqueducts. These engineering marvels not only showcased Roman ingenuity but also served practical purposes, from public entertainment to water supply.

2. What is IMC?
Integrated marketing communication (IMC) is the process
of combining all methods of brand advertising in order to
advertise a specific product or service to a target audience.
Both facets of marketing communication work together in
integrated marketing communication to improve revenue
and reduce costs.
3. Importance of IMC
● Plays a crucial role in spreading the brand's message to a wider
audience.
● At a low cost, it goes a long way toward can brand recognition
among consumers.
● It outperforms conventional marketing methods because it focuses
not just on attracting new customers but also on maintaining a
long-term, stable relationship with them.
● Ensures a two-way conversation with customers

7. Advertisements & Internet
● On October 27, 1994, the first online ad was posted. It was a banner
advertisement added to a web page
● Two-thirds (66%) of businesses invest in online advertising
● Social media advertising (86%), display advertising (80%), and paid search
marketing (66%) are the most popular online advertising channels that
businesses use
● Marketing products and services online provides the ability to target audience
based on demography, dispelling the myth that advertising is sales-oriented.
8. 1. Always #LikeAGirl
Research discovered that more than
one-half of women claimed they
experienced a decline in confidence at
puberty. The Always creative team
was drawn to the derogatory phrase
“like a girl” and developed an
integrated marketing campaign to
transform it to a phrase of
empowerment.
2. Southwest Airlines
Transfarency
The airline has a microsite for
its Transfarency campaign that
showcases the value customers
will receive by choosing
Southwest over other airlines. It
includes several sections of
informational and fun content.
Successful IMC Campaigns
9. Successful IMC Campaigns
3. Domino's AnyWare
Pizza restaurant chain Domino’s
created the “AnyWare” campaign to
help people order food in more
convenient ways. Domino’s AnyWare
allows customers to order with a
tweet, a text, Ford Sync, smart
televisions and smart watches.
4. “The Martian” Movie Prologue
The prologue campaign for “The
Martian” movie tried to overturn
historically negative box office results
for films about Mars. Using an
integrated marketing strategy, the
goal was to bring the world of the
movie to life and foster the same
excitement of the Cold War-era space
race.
